The aim of this work is to study starbursts and the dynamical processes involved, both from gas and stellar components. For this purpose, one nearby galaxy with a nuclear starburst was selected, as well as a sample of 6 ultraluminous infrared galaxies (ULIRGs). Observations of these sources were carried out with SINFONI, the spectrograph for integral field observations in the near-infrared, an instrument that is mounted on the VLT in Chile. The thesis contains a study of the spectral features that are characteristic for starbursts, and a comparison of dynamical masses and mass-to-light ratios of the ULIRGs, calculated with different methods both from stellar dynamics and gas dynamics.
